> I know that the fractional E1-setiings of ComOS 3.8.x are broken,
> a special fix for this should be available via Lucent....
What is wrong, just make sure you don't set channel 1 for anything as this
is the frame sync channel. Use channels 2-32.
On ComOS 3.9 and 4.1 the channels have been renamed so that you should use
channels 1-31.
The frame sync channel has been removed from the list in 3.9 and 4.1 ComOS.
